Pretty sure it was Carroll. Qld left a spot in the side as TBC as players named in Origin are ineligible to be named for their club, so Broncos 'picked' him, which counted as his suspension, so on the following Monday Qld confirmed he was their TBC.

I am pretty sure the wording of suspensions is "__ weeks or rounds", not games; therefore if rep matches happen to also fall in those weeks then bad luck - you miss them too.
